CLEAR transforms what is uniquely you – your fingerprints, your face, your eyes – into a secure, biometric key to frictionless experiences. We are creating a world where travel is effortless, where accessing your office building is as simple as walking in, and where shopping is as easy as walking in and out of a store—without ever once showing an ID or credit card. CLEAR currently powers secure, frictionless customer experiences in nearly 40 U.S. airports and venues. With over 3 million members so far, CLEAR is the identity platform of the future, today.

CLEAR is looking for a service centric and impeccably organized Launch Coordinator to support our Operations teams in partner launches. This is a fast-paced, hands-on, and exciting role that requires a can-do person who can work with both autonomy and efficiency.

What You Will Do:

  • Assist Operations teams with partner launches
  • Liaise internally with various departments/teams and externally with clients as needed
  • Handle most administrative duties associated with partner launches
  • Assist with scheduling and coordinating logistics associated with new launch locations, often occurring simultaneously in multiple cities
  • Follow up with internal stakeholders to track the progress of launches on an ongoing basis.
  • Work with vendors to coordinate launch logistics and detail planning
  • Coordinate shipments, supplies, and receipts to new launch sites
  • Support calendaring and logistical lift for managers as needed

     

Who You Are:

  • 1+ years experience in coordination, administrative or operations preferred. Project management experience a plus
  • Impeccable and proven customer service skills
  • Ability to travel domestically as necessary
  • Exemplary written and verbal communication skills
  • Highly organized with the ability to multitask and meet deadlines
  • Resourceful, extremely organized, detail oriented, and a team player
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office and/or G-Suite
  • Scrappy, unflappable, dynamic
  • Motivated, driven and a self-starter
